ChenXin
38c2ef7d74
修改 callback 的测试文件
7 years ago
ChenXin
1c9a0b5875
把暂不发布的功能移到 legacy 文件夹
7 years ago
ChenXin
6cb75104b8
修改 tutorials 的测试文件
7 years ago
ChenXin
8a7bf58244
delete an old metric in test
7 years ago
ChenXin
902a3a6bcd
修改了一些注释
7 years ago
yh_cc
349194fe85
删除用于分词的metric,因为有可能引起错误
7 years ago
yh_cc
56ff4ac7a1
统一不同位置的seq_len_to_mask, 现统一到core.utils.seq_len_to_mask
7 years ago
yh_cc
af6a9da78d
Merge branch 'dev' of github.com:choosewhatulike/fastNLP-private into dev
7 years ago
yh_cc
6d36dbe7fb
完善测试
7 years ago
yunfan
702fa1d95c
- update attention
- fix tests
7 years ago
yh
25565fe0c9
增加cnn的测试
7 years ago
ChenXin
4926b33df0
core部分的测试和一些小修改
7 years ago
ChenXin
8039f4dd45
讨论并整合了若干模块
7 years ago
yh
b7613cdb7d
conflict solve
7 years ago
yh_cc
b9558e21e6
1. 从安装文件中删除api/automl的安装
2. metric中存在seq_len的bug
3. sampler中存在命名错误,已修改
7 years ago
yunfan
4f65e17d1a
- add model runner for easier test models
- add model tests
7 years ago
yh
16388d5698
修改部分注释
7 years ago
yunfan
e864aecb03
- add Const
- fix bugs
7 years ago
yunfan
799d4dbc68
- add test
- fix jsonloader
7 years ago
yh_cc
ded4228f93
1.增加对Trainer和Tester的多卡支持;
7 years ago
yh_cc
5e9c406761
修改embedding为init_embed初始化
7 years ago
yh_cc
f65c0935f6
Merge branch 'dev' of github.com:choosewhatulike/fastNLP-private into dev
7 years ago
yh_cc
06891cf90a
补充注释,并修改部分代码
7 years ago
xuyige
ee49f4177e
update char level encoder
7 years ago
yh_cc
6e265e5ae9
完善了trainer,callback等的文档; 修改了部分代码的命名以使得代码从文档中隐藏
7 years ago
xuyige
55783314bc
update documents on metrics
7 years ago
yh_cc
7997dce8a7
对DataSet的文档进行更新
7 years ago
yh_cc
66ad7d9bf9
Merge branch 'dev' of github.com:choosewhatulike/fastNLP-private into dev
7 years ago
yh_cc
28ece53df0
本地暂存
7 years ago
yunfan
001586fa3e
- add document
7 years ago
yh
2c202bb151
测试文档
7 years ago
yunfan
abff8d9daa
- fix test_tutorial
7 years ago
yunfan
e025350ea8
Merge branch 'dev' of https://github.com/choosewhatulike/fastNLP-private into pr
7 years ago
yunfan
c344f7a2f9
- add pad sequence for lstm
- add csv, conll, json filereader
- update dataloader
- remove useless dataloader
- fix trainer loss print
- fix tests
7 years ago
yh_cc
c1ee0b27df
1.DataSet.apply()报错时提供错误的index
2.Vocabulary.from_dataset(), index_dataset()提供报错时的vocab顺序
3.embedloader在embed读取时遇到不规则的数据跳过这一行.
7 years ago
yh_cc
b69f8985c8
1. 在embedding_loader中增加新的读取函数load_with_vocab(), load_without_vocab, 比之前的函数改变主要在(1)不再需要传入embed_dim(2)自动判断当前是word2vec还是glove.
2. vocabulary增加from_dataset(), index_dataset()函数。避免需要多行写index dataset的问题。
3. 在utils中新增一个cache_result()修饰器,用于cache函数的返回值。
4. callback中新增update_every属性
7 years ago
yh_cc
29f81e79ad
准备发布0.4.0版本“
7 years ago
yh
dffd9b96cd
合并冲突
7 years ago
yh
4d1721ffe3
修改部分bug;调整callback
7 years ago
yunfan
f4e64906d4
- fix callback & tests
7 years ago
yunfan
e12041513f
Merge remote-tracking branch 'private/dev' into pr
# Conflicts:
# fastNLP/core/callback.py
# fastNLP/core/trainer.py
7 years ago
yunfan
58f373d371
- fix test
7 years ago
yunfan
70fb4a2284
- add star transformer model
- add ConllLoader, for all kinds of conll-format files
- add JsonLoader, for json-format files
- add SSTLoader, for SST-2 & SST-5
- change Callback interface
- fix batch multi-process when killed
- add README to list models and their performance
7 years ago
yh
ec90a1f0bb
Merge branch 'dev' of github.com:choosewhatulike/fastNLP-private into dev
7 years ago
yh
e5f68bbd5b
修复CRF为负数的bug
7 years ago
FengZiYjun
6a498bbdf2
* 给vocabulary添加遍历方法
7 years ago
FengZiYjun
f5ab7a5d45
* 将enas相关代码放到automl目录下
* 修复fast_param_mapping的一个bug
* Trainer添加自动创建save目录
* Vocabulary的打印,显示内容
7 years ago
FengZiYjun
ef0c6e936d
Changes to Callbacks:
* 给callback添加给定几个只读属性
* 通过manager设置这些属性
* 代码优化,减轻@transfer的负担
7 years ago
yh
f2d7d01bb7
修复CRF中可能存在的bug
7 years ago
yunfan
7c7f28f2ac
- add star-transformer
7 years ago